Why the Global Market Wants Tiger Nuts

There has been a significant rise in demand for tiger nuts in markets such as Europe, North America, Asia, and the Middle East due to:

  • Nutritional Benefits: Rich in fiber, magnesium, iron, potassium, and resistant starch.

  • Health & Wellness Trends: Ideal for vegan, paleo, and diabetic diets.

  • Dairy Alternatives: Used to produce tiger nut milk (horchata) as a lactose-free alternative.

  • Gluten-Free Ingredients: Ground into flour for baking, cereals, and snacks.

  • Natural Oils & Cosmetics: Tiger nut oil is valued in skincare formulations.

With demand rising across multiple sectors, the global market is seeking reliable African suppliers who can meet quality, volume, and compliance needs.


Nigeria – One of the World’s Leading Tiger Nut Producers

Nigeria is naturally suited for tiger nut cultivation due to its fertile soil and warm climate. The northern regions, including Kaduna, Kano, Jigawa, and Plateau States, produce large volumes of tiger nuts annually. These nuts are typically harvested twice a year, sun-dried, and sorted for commercial use.

Trade Specifications – Tiger Nuts from Nigeria

  • Product Name: Tiger Nuts (Dry, Cleaned, Export Grade)

  • Origin: Nigeria

  • Size: Mixed or uniform (based on buyer requirement)

  • Moisture Content: ≤10%

  • Purity: ≥98% clean, stone-free

  • Packaging: 25kg or 50kg PP woven sacks (custom packaging on request)

  • Minimum Order Quantity: 5 Metric Tonnes

  • Port of Loading: Lagos, Nigeria

  • Shipping Time: 5–10 working days after confirmation of payment

  • Payment Terms: Bank Guarantee / Part Payment / LPO

  • Export Documents: Full export documentation provided
